France's President Emmanuel Macron got his official photo taken the other day. It's basically like at school when you used to get your photo, except his lunches are probably a bit better than yours, he has more flags and he doesn't have to wear a school jumper.

It's a nice snap. I reckon his mum will probably buy a copy of it in one of those cardboard frames and put it on the mantelpiece.

But as nice a photo as it is, that hasn't deterred the people of the internet from turning it into a meme and plastering it all over Twitter with the hashtag #PoseTonMacron, or 'pose your Macron'.
